Ingredients for Best Cream Cheese Cookies
To create these delicious Best Cream Cheese Cookies, you’ll need the following ingredients:
- 1 cup (226g) unsalted butter, softened: This creates a rich base with an irresistible flavor.
- 3 oz (85g) cream cheese, softened: Adds a lovely tanginess and keeps the cookies soft and moist.
- 1 cup (200g) granulated sugar: Sweetens the dough nicely, balancing the cream cheese’s flavor.
- 1 large egg yolk: Helps bind the ingredients and enriches the dough.
- 1 tsp vanilla extract: Infuses the cookies with a warm, aromatic essence.
- 2 cups (240g) all-purpose flour: Forms the structure of the cookies.
- 1/2 tsp baking powder: Provides just enough lift for a delightful texture.
- 1/4 tsp salt: Balances sweetness and enhances flavors.
- Extra granulated sugar or powdered sugar for dusting (optional): Finishing touch for a hint of sweetness.
Step-by-Step Directions
Beat the Butter and Cream Cheese: In a large mixing bowl, combine the softened butter and cream cheese. Beat them together until light and fluffy, about 2-3 minutes. This step is crucial for achieving the perfect texture in your cookies.
Incorporate Sugar and Egg: Add the granulated sugar to the fluffy mixture and beat again until well combined. Then mix in the egg yolk and vanilla extract until everything is nicely blended.
Prepare the Dry Ingredients: In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t. This step ensures your dry ingredients are evenly distributed before adding them to the wet mixture.
Combine the Mixtures: Gradually add your dry mixture to the wet ingredients. Beat on lower speed just until a soft dough forms. Be careful not to overmix, or your cookies may turn out tough.
Chill the Dough: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and chill in the refrigerator for 30-45 minutes. Chilling allows the flavors to meld and makes the dough easier to handle.
Preheat Your Oven: While the dough chills, pre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line your baking sheets with parchment paper.
Shape the Cookies: Scoop 1 tablespoon of dough, roll it into a ball, and place each ball about 2 inches apart on the prepared baking sheets. Gently press down on each ball to flatten slightly.
Bake: Bake for 10–12 minutes or until the edges are just starting to turn golden brown. Allow the cookies to cool completely before dusting with extra sugar if desired. This last touch adds a delightful finishing sparkle.
Tips & Tricks for Best Cream Cheese Cookies
To elevate your baking game, consider these chef’s secrets:
Room Temperature Ingredients: Ensure your butter and cream cheese are at room temperature for a smoother mix and fluffy cookies.
Add a Zest: For a citrus twist, consider adding lemon or orange zest to the dough before baking. It brightens the flavor and adds an aromatic fragrance as they bake.
Chill Longer: If you’re not in a rush, chilling the dough longer, even overnight, allows the flavors to develop further.
Variations: Feel free to add in mini chocolate chips, nuts, or dried fruits for a unique spin on these cookies.

Storing Tips & Variations for Best Cream Cheese Cookies
To keep your cookies fresh, store them in an airtight container at room temperature for up to one week. You can also freeze the cookie dough before baking for a quick treat anytime—just scoop the dough into balls and freeze on a baking tray before transferring to a file. When ready to bake, just pop them directly into the preheated oven without thawing. For healthier swaps, consider using whole wheat flour or substituting half the butter with unsweetened applesauce for a lower-fat version. FAQs
1. How do I know when my cookies are done?
The edges should be lightly golden brown. They will continue to firm up as they cool.
2. Can I use low-fat cream cheese?
Yes, you can use low-fat cream cheese, but the texture might be slightly different, and the cookies may not be as rich.
3. Can I freeze the cookies after baking?
Absolutely! Just wait until they cool completely before storing them in an airtight container or freezer bag.
4. How can I make these cookies gluten-free?
You can substitute the all-purpose flour with a gluten-free flour blend that includes xanthan gum for the best results.
5. What can I do with leftover egg whites?
Leftover egg whites can be used to make meringues, angel food cake, or added to smoothies for extra protein.
